I searched and didn't see it here, so forgive me if this is already well known. In the WSJ today the article titled "Rethinking the Halo Car" states:

Separately, Honda Motor Co. said it will discontinue the Honda S2000 roadster after this year. Honda sold just 2,538 of these cars in 2008, down 41% from the year before. The S2000 is 10 years old, and Honda says the model has outlived the company's original plan -- which was to build a limited run of the cars as a tribute to the company's 50th anniversary.
